Bangladesh, Dec. 14 -- Growing unease is spreading among Western officials over a series of secretive meetings between senior Ukrainian negotiators and top officials from the US Federal Bureau of Investigation, raising uncomfortable questions about the true purpose of the talks, the direction of Washingtons Ukraine policy, and the deepening corruption crisis surrounding President Vladimir Zelenskys inner circle.
